Hi,
So this one is rather interesting
2 days ago i got a email in the evening saying my order was in progress and when i look at my account to check it, it seems they are sending me a new Smart Hub 2 and are also sending me a bag to send back my existing Smart Hub 2 and if i don’t return it, they will charge me £50…
So straight on the BT Chat, 55min wait…. tried phoning waiting best part 20mins on phone and gave up, stayed on chat.. eventually someone came back to me, told them i never placed this order and seems daft as I already have a smart hub 2 so why send another one when I have it, can they cancel it and I keep existing one and not be charged the £50 they said ok, they have cancelled it and I wont need to pay the £50 and can keep existing Smart Hub 2. Great.
Next day, check my email, no email to confirm its cancelled, check my orders and its still there as open order, no notes etc… so this was prob lunch time next day, get on the chat again, go through it all again, they apologies, say they will cancel it. great, check later that evening it shows “partial cancellation” next to the delivery section of the new hub but nothing against the return of existing one.
So bacon the chat – now rather fed up with it now, seems a stupid system. Went through again, they then said device been sent due tomorrow (today) and they can’t cancel it. I advised them I’ll be at work and n one can take delivery, so what will happen? They said if no one in they will return it to them and then that’s fine I can keep existing and I wont be charged the £50 but they can’t cancel the order as device has been sent.
Post guy has instead left it at my door….. good job no one has taken it as I’d then be on the hook for another £50…. not impressed at all.
So now waiting back to send one one back – what a fiasco when I literally don’t need another one, already have it..
Seems daft they arrange it late in the evening and then it arrives 2 days later and you can’t cancel it etc as the process is under way. Imagine if I had been on holiday for example, it would be sat at my door for a week or 2…..
